Here is the issue. Before when I would put Quicktime into full screen, it would go into full screen on the monitor it was visible on.
I merely looked at the Full Screen options tab in the preferences and now it will only go the monitor specified in there. I can not set it back to the previous behavior. Is there any way to fix this? Quicktime 7.1.5/6 and OS X 10.4.9 |
